
The Energy Efficiency in Government Operations (EEGO) Policy requires the preparation of an annual whole-of-government report on the total energy use and estimated greenhouse gas emissions of Australian Government departments and agencies.
The primary function of the annual reports is to:
- present a breakdown of energy use in the Australian Government's operations, according to activity type, portfolio and agency
- compare Australian Government agencies' energy efficiency in relation to the targets set in the EEGO policy
- present a best estimate of the greenhouse gas emissions resulting from the activities of the Australian Government.
The reporting process is subject to public scrutiny through tabling of the report in Parliament.
